Location:
Other, LATAM
Seniority:
Middle
Technologies:
Java

Our partner is one of the largest retail e-commerce companies in North America, serving millions of customers each year and ensuring a secure and seamless shopping experience across digital and in‑store channels.

We’re looking for a Backend Engineer to join the Enterprise Fraud Intelligence team, which is responsible for building and maintaining systems that detect, prevent, and mitigate fraudulent activities across the organization.

The role focuses on developing scalable, distributed, and real‑time data processing systems that support fraud detection pipelines and event-driven architectures. You will work across the full software development lifecycle — from system design and implementation to production support, monitoring, and on‑call responsibilities.

This is a hands-on engineering role requiring strong Java expertise, deep understanding of streaming technologies, and experience operating high‑load, cloud‑native systems. You will contribute to mission‑critical services that directly impact business security, customer trust, and operational resilience.

  • Design, implement, and maintain scalable and reliable software solutions using Java and Spring Boot.

  • Architect and build distributed systems leveraging Kafka Streams and other real-time data processing frameworks.

  • Develop and maintain RESTful APIs to support seamless integration and communication between systems.

  • Collaborate with DevOps teams to deploy and manage applications on Kubernetes, ensuring scalability, reliability, and security.

  • Work with cloud platforms like AWS and GCP to build and optimize cloud-native applications

  • System Monitoring & Troubleshooting - Splunk New Relic

  • Apply strong object-oriented design principles and design patterns to create maintainable and extensible codebases.

  • Participate in code reviews, technical discussions, and team collaboration to deliver high-quality software solutions

  • 3-5+ years of professional experience in software engineering, with a focus on backend development.

  • Strong proficiency in Java and hands-on experience with Spring Boot.

  • Experience with streaming technologies such as Kafka Streams and Apache Flink.

  • Deep understanding of object-oriented design principles and design patterns.

  • Hands-on experience with Kafka for message streaming and event-driven architectures.

  • Proficiency with containerization and orchestration tools, especially Kubernetes.

  • Experience with cloud platforms like AWS and/or GCP.

  • Expertise in building and consuming RESTful APIs.

  • Strong problem-solving skills, with the ability to troubleshoot complex systems.

  • Excellent communication skills and the ability to work effectively in a collaborative, team-oriented environment.

Discover what it’s like to work with us
Join Our Team!
Attaching my CV:
Your message is sent. Thank you for contacting us, we will get in touch with you soon.